Gothevian
Etymology 1
Inherited from Gothic *𐍂𐌰𐌹𐌳𐌰 (*raida). Cognate to English road, Dutch rede, Norwegian Nynorsk rei, Icelandic reið.
Pronunciation
- IPA: /ˈrja.zɨ/
Noun
raízy (raízy) f (plural raízyš, definite raízun, relational adjective raízɛin)
- travel, journey, trip
- (figurative) train of thought, thought path
- Synonyms: frázɛiny raízy (frázɛiny raízy), raízy zy frázuš (raízy zy frázuš)
